Crock-Pot Cooking – Hearty, Homeade Beef Stew

You Will Need:
4 pounds bottom round, well trimmed and cut into 2-inch pieces
1 cup all-purpose flour
1/3 cup olive oil
2 large onions, diced
1 6-ounce can tomato paste
1 cup dry red wine
1 pound potatoes, cut into 2-inch pieces
1/2 pound baby carrots
2 cups beef broth (add another 1/2 cup if you want it thinner)
1 tablespoon kosher salt
1 teaspoon dried thyme leaves
1 bay leaf
Directions:
Coat beef cubes in the flour. Heat a few tablespoons of the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Brown the meat.
Place beef in 4- to 6-quart crock-pot
Add the onions to the skillet and cook over medium heat until tender, about 10 minutes. Stir in the tomato paste and coat the onions; transfer to the cooker.
Pour the wine into the skillet and scrape up any browned bits; add to the cooker. Add the potatoes, carrots, broth, salt, thyme, and bay leaf.
Cover and cook on low heat for 7 1/2 hours, or on high for 4 hours.

Recipe serves 8-10.
